Output c066af781221a2f340544e79371ce053d7f6131487a3293a67fcebb5a684ca72:1

value
20741658
script pubkey
OP_HASH160 OP_PUSHBYTES_20 35c9900fdb778014808be81393164352daae609a OP_EQUAL
address
MCoZWRRyLwnk3DkadQjtcCh7syBfwDMqmE
transaction
c066af781221a2f340544e79371ce053d7f6131487a3293a67fcebb5a684ca72
spent
true